Our private hire speakeasy style ballroom at Brickhouse on New Wakefield Street is perfect for all types of events; corporate events, birthdays, intimate wedding receptions, screenings and parties.
The private space offers it's own bar, leather seating area, pool table, extensive cocktail menu, large HD screen and toilet facilities. You can bring your own music or there are DJ facilities with a surround sound music system. Bespoke buffet meal packages can be purchased.
The ballroom is adjourning to our karaoke booth which can be booked in conjunction for any one who wants to sing the night away!
